AeroBase Group is a supplier of various aircraft parts, military parts, ground support equipment, and maritime parts. They carry OEM, and Government Excess Surplus, as well as PMA Parts. Through an RFQ process, Aerobase contacted me about a part-which they (Starleigh) claimed was in stock and had a "fresh tag" (i. E. certified recently). She requested that funds be wired and that the lead time will be 7-10 days. A few days after being sold the part, Starleigh contacted me to let me know that the tag was 2004 and in order to get an updated tag, it had to be sent to a shop in Canada. We asked how long it would take. She never got back to us. After speaking with her manager Corey, 11 business days after placing the order, he explained that the part was not assembled, and that Aerobase could not honor the sale. This is 11 business days AFTER placing the order, and telling our end buyer that the product was being recertified--as it was initially explained to us. After explaining to Corey that our end buyer was waiting w/ an AOG, he said that he could not find the part, we found the part in Canada (at a higher cost) but Aerobase was unwilling to sustain the loss, even though errors on their part, both from office and warehouse workers, was blatant. We requested to speak to a manager, but just received a voicemail that a refund check was issued (note, he did not offer to refund the wire transfer fee or to wire the funds, which was the way they received it--who knows when it will get here). I would not recommend Aerobase, and will be filing complaints w/ the BBB and other organizations so that customers are more aware of their gross misconduct, dishonesty, and unwillingness to provide quality customer service and satisfaction, when they are 100% at fault.
